Norskwood Cordelia 'Cordy' |
||||||||||
Norskwood Cordelia (or Cordy as we call her) is from Buffy's first litter of kittens and was born on 24th May 2005. We hadn't intended to keep any of the kittens, but Cordy decided that she was going to stay with us. For a couple of months we worried that we'd have the World's first Norwegian Shorthair as Cordy's coat had been zealously over groomed by her Mum and "Auntie" Willow, and it took ages to grow back! Fortunately, it has come back with full force and she has a lovely full coat now. Even her whiskers, which had been gnawed on by her brothers and sisters have made a remarkable recovery of late. Cordy is a pretty Brown Ticked Tabby with good boning and we're hoping that she'll develop into a breeding Queen in time. She was the shyest of the litter, but she is very loving and likes nothing better than to share Ali's pillow at night. As she is growing rapidly, this might not be a viable option for too much longer. Cordy is fast friends with Izzy and Willow. She gets on well with all the other cats, but often irritates her Mother when she gets the wind up her tail and becomes too boisterous! Watch this space to see her grow up. Cordy has done well as a kitten at both GCCF and FIFe shows and we were especially proud when she came 3rd in a class of 8 girls at the National Cat Club Show in December 2005, and when she was up for Nomination for Best in Show at the FIFe show in Welwyn in March 2006. She will now be going out occasionally to shows in the Adult classes where we hope that she will continue her success. Cordy won her first Champion Certificate at the Felis Britannica Show at Tonbridge on 16th July 2006 and was also put forward for Nomination. She behaved impeccably and was much admired even though it was a blisteringly hot day. Cordy came to the FIFe Garden of England show at Swanley on the 20th and 21st October 2007. She won her Open class both days giving her the 2nd and 3rd CAC’s that she needed and she is now a FIFe Champion. She was also up for Nomination on both days- she is our very first home grown titled cat, and because she‘s from our first ever litter of kittens, that makes her very special. Cordy came to the Viking Cat Club Show in Rugby in December. She came second in her CACIB class on Saturday, but won the class on Sunday and was up against Greebo for BIV (he narrowly beat her!), and was also up for Nomination. |
